Oh, Michael, we were rooting for you.
On Sunday night, Michael Keaton lost the Oscar for Best Actor for his role in Birdman to Eddie Redmayne for his portrayal of Stephen Hawking in The Theory of Everything.

While most of us fell under the charm of Redmayne's gracious and giddy acceptance speech, one Vine user captured a heartbreaking moment after Keaton learned he hadn't won.

It looks like Keaton quickly and subtly tucked a piece of paper -- likely his acceptance speech -- into his jacket pocket, never to see the light of day again.
Leo knows just how you feel (times 1 million).
Birdman did take home four Oscars on Sunday, though, including for Best Picture.
